The Bay Area is the hardest place in the country to build housing, and 4C's home market. Our facility at 2447 Industrial Parkway in Hayward sits in the middle of a region that needs an enormous amount of new housing and struggles to deliver it under conventional methods. Under the current Regional Housing Needs Allocation (RHNA), the nine-county Bay Area is expected to plan for roughly 441,000 new homes between 2023 and 2031, a pace of about 55,000 units a year. Actual production is running far below that: San Francisco had permitted only a small fraction of its eight-year target by the end of 2025, and San Jose's largest homebuilders together closed on the order of 1,000 homes in a year against an allocation of more than 62,000. The gap between what the region plans for and what it builds is where a faster construction method matters most.
The most expensive construction market in the country
Cost is the first wall every Bay Area project runs into. New residential construction here is routinely estimated in the range of $400 to $800 per square foot and higher, several times the national average, and San Francisco regularly ranks among the most expensive cities in the world to build in, driven by land, seismic requirements, Title 24 energy standards, and labor. Affordable multifamily development in California now often exceeds $400,000 to $500,000 per unit, with Bay Area metros at the top of that range. When each unit costs that much to deliver, shaving time and labor off the build is not a marginal saving, it's the difference between a project penciling out and stalling.
Manufacturing the building is one of the few levers that moves that number. A March 2026 study from UC Berkeley's Terner Center found that off-site and factory-built methods can cut construction time by 20 to 30% and total development costs by 5 to 20%, and California lawmakers have increasingly pointed to factory-built housing as central to the state's supply strategy. A shrinking, aging trades workforce
The second wall is labor. Roughly two-thirds of California contractors report skilled-worker shortages as their top constraint, and the trades most in demand, framers, electricians, plumbers, HVAC, are the same ones every Bay Area project competes for at once. Prefabrication directly relieves that pressure: by moving the bulk of assembly into a controlled plant staffed by a consistent crew, panelized construction has been shown to reduce on-site labor requirements by 15 to 20%. For a Bay Area GC trying to staff a project in a tight market, that means fewer trades to sequence on a cramped site and a schedule far less exposed to who is available on a given week. Infill and ADUs on land that barely exists
Buildable land is scarce across the Bay Area, so much of the region's new housing is infill: ADUs, backyard cottages, and small multifamily projects on tight urban and suburban lots. California has become the national center of ADU construction, now accounting for close to a third of all US ADU permits, and the Bay Area's own ADU volume has more than doubled since 2020. Wildfire exposure in the East Bay and North Bay hills
Not all of the region is flat urban infill. More than a million Bay Area homes now sit in the wildland-urban interface, and in several North Bay counties the large majority of housing falls within it. California's updated 2025 WUI building standards require ember-resistant materials and stricter assemblies for construction in those zones.
